Gorilla Glass is great for the former but not so great for the latter. Tempered glass screen protectors are, as you said, designed to shatter. It'll absorb as much energy as possible while keeping it away from your precious screen. It's easier and less costly to replace a broken glass screen protector than a broken screen.

That's why we still recommend using a screen protector if you're worried about the Pixel's long-term durability. Replacing a scratched or shattered screen protector is easy. Getting a shattered phone display repaired is a bit more complicated โ and more expensive. Gorilla Glass Victus is an excellent layer of protection to have on the Pixel 6
